Definitions:

Z-score

A statistical measure representing the number of standard deviations a data point is from the mean of a distribution.

Standard Deviation

An indicator that calculates the degree to which data points vary or are spread out in a dataset.

IQR

The interquartile range, a measure of variability, expressed as the difference between the 25th and 75th percentiles of the data.

Median

The middle value in a data set, which divides the data into two halves when arranged in order.
